Summon shifts Model 3 into Drive or Reverse
(based on the direction you specified) and
drives into or out of the parking space. When
parking is complete, or if an obstacle is
detected, Summon shifts Model 3 into Park.
Summon shifts Model 3 into Park when:
• Model 3 detects an obstacle in its driving
path (within the Bumper Clearance setting
that you specified).
• Summon has moved Model 3 the
maximum distance of 12 meters.
• You release the FORWARD or REVERSE
button (when Require Continuous Press is
turned on) .
• You press any button to manually stop
Summon.
If you used Summon to park Model 3, you can
then use Summon to return Model 3 back to
its original position (provided the vehicle has
remained in Park), or to the maximum
Summon Distance that you have specified
(whichever comes first). Simply specify the
opposite direction on the mobile app and
Summon moves the vehicle along the original
path, provided no obstructions have been
introduced. If the ultrasonic sensors detect an
obstacle, Summon attempts to avoid the
obstacle while staying very close to its original
path (Summon does not steer around
obstacles).
Note: To move Summon multiple times in the
same direction (not to exceed the maximum
of 12 meters, cancel Summon and then restart
the parking process using the same direction.
Note: Although Summon can move Model 3 a
short distance laterally to avoid an obstacle, it
does not attempt to steer around an obstacle
to return the vehicle to its original driving
path.
Note: Summon requires that Model 3 can
detect a valid key nearby.
Note: Summon requires that Model 3 can
detect an authenticated phone nearby.
Warning:
Model 3 cannot detect
obstacles that are located lower than the
bumper, are very narrow (i.e. bicycles), or
are hanging from a ceiling. In addition,
many unforeseen circumstances can
impair Summon's ability to move in or out
of a parking space and, as a result,
Summon may not move Model 3
appropriately. Therefore, you must
continually monitor the vehicle's
movement and its surroundings and
remain prepared to stop Model 3 at any
time.
Operating Summon with the Key
Note: Summon may not operate if the key fob
accessory's battery is low.
Follow these steps to park Model 3 from
outside the vehicle using the key fob
accessory:
1. On the touchscreen, ensure that Require
Continuous Press is disabled (touch
Controls > Autopilot > Summon > Require
Continuous Press > NO).
2. With Model 3 in Park, stand within 3
meters and press and hold the top center
button on the key fob accessory (Lock/
Unlock All button) until the hazard lights
blink continuously.
Note: The hazard lights flash once as
Model 3 locks, then within five seconds,
Model 3 powers on and the hazard lights
flash continuously. Do not proceed to the
next step until the hazard lights are
flashing. If, after five seconds, the hazard
lights are not flashing, release the button
on the key fob accessory, move closer to
Model 3, and try again. If Summon
receives no further input within ten
seconds, Summon cancels.
3. Press the Front Trunk button on the key
fob accessory to move Model 3 forward
into the parking space, or press the Rear
Trunk button to reverse Model 3 into the
parking space.
